Organization

The documentation are organized in individual PDF documents, each module and printed board has its own PDF document. Each PDF document is composed by the next documents:

  1. 3D view
  2. Schematic view of the circuit
  3. Mechanical view of the board
  4. Track view of the board
  5. BOM list
  6. Assembly reference list

I strongly recommended to use the assembly reference list during the assembly of your modules to avoid mistakes and the need to unsoldering components and to use the mechanical view to check the orientation of some components and ICs and avoid mistakes as well.

Color codes

The color code of the tracks and layers view is:

  1. Top Layer – Green
  2. Mid Layer – Orange (GND layer)
  3. Mid Layer – Red (PWR layer)
  4. Bottom Layer – Blue

About NetLabels

In the schematics I made use of net labels so much instead of wiring connections, I think improve understanding and readability of the schematics on digital circuits with lot of connections. So if you are used to more to wirings, keep this in mind and pay special attention to net labels. Remember, a net label is another way to connect pins in a schematic. Other advantage of the use of custom net labels is that their names appear in the PCB diagram instead and autogenerated net label name and help a lot to design the PCB routing.

Pay special attention to net labels when read the schematics of myCPU
